La Makita Soma

Monkey Island

BY Ian DanzigPublished Sep 1, 1999

This rhythm-based Chicago-area collaboration combines trumpet, vibes and beguiling analogue electronics with traditional rock instrumentation for a hypnotic take on jazzy dub rock. The instrumental compositions groove through beautifully layered textures of rhythm and melody. In addition to recording and performing together, this five piece also live together, which might explain the fluidity of ideas in the strong ensemble writing that appears to be culled from lengthy jam sessions. Comparisons to Thrill Jockey types like Trans Am and Tortoise should be expected due to the incessant groove and instrumental ingenuity involved, but musically La Makita Soma owes more to pop and rock with crafty melodic phrases often taking centre stage.
